76 Host camping area is a fantastic camping destination in South Carolina. Situated in a beautiful natural setting, this campground offers a range of amenities to make your camping experience comfortable and enjoyable. With its spacious campsites, clean restrooms, and convenient access to recreational activities, 76 Host provides everything you need for a memorable camping trip.

Reservations are accepted at this campground, allowing you to secure your spot in advance. This is particularly helpful during peak seasons when campsites fill up quickly. It is recommended to make a reservation to ensure availability, especially if you plan to visit during the busier months.

The best time of year to visit 76 Host camping area is during the spring and fall seasons when the weather is mild and pleasant. These times offer ideal conditions for various outdoor activities, such as hiking, fishing, and bird-watching. However, it's important to check weather forecasts and be prepared for occasional rain showers or thunderstorms.

While camping at 76 Host, visitors should be cautious of wildlife encounters, particularly with snakes and insects. It is advisable to wear appropriate clothing, apply insect repellent, and be aware of your surroundings to ensure a safe and enjoyable camping experience. Additionally, campers should follow all camping regulations and guidelines to protect the environment and maintain the campground's natural beauty.
